Bootstrap

iview组件中的DatePicker的type=“datetimerange“类型双击一个时间要求将结束时间改为23:59:59

iview组件中的DatePicker的type="datetimerange"类型双击一个时间要求将结束时间改为23:59:59

<DatePicker
              ref="dataPicker"
              :options="options"
              v-model="selectDate"
              type="datetimerange"
              @click.native="nativeClickTime('dataPickerA','selectDate')" //selectDate为v-model的值
              format="yyyy-MM-dd HH:mm:ss"
              clearable
              placeholder="选择日期后 点击选择具体时间"
              style="width: 330px"
            ></DatePicker>
nativeClickTime(ref,name) {
     const target = this.$refs[ref].$refs["pickerPanel"];
     target.handlePickClick = () => {
       // 这里加这么一段
       const { from, selecting,to } = target["rangeState"];
       console.log(target.isTime)
       if (to && !selecting && target.isTime===false){
         this[name]=[from,new Date(new Date(to).getTime()+24*60*60*1000-1)]
       }
     };
   },//设置选择后的时间格式
;